India concerned at Israeli excavations near Al Aqsa
New Delhi, Feb 20 (UNI) India tonight expressed concern at the possible consequences of the ''repair activities'' by Israel around the Al Aqsa mosque in Jerusalem and called for maintaining the sanctity and spiritual heritage of the Holy City.
An External Affairs Ministry spokesman said the Old City of Jerusalem, including the excavation site, are places of great spiritual significance to the followers of the three monotheistic religions.
The peace, sanctity and spiritual heritage of this Holy City should be maintained, he said.
The spokesman said any action that could be construed as affecting the sanctity of this World Heritage Site, which is the common heritage of all mankind, should be avoided at all costs.
